创建自定义异常类基类 app/lib/exception/BaseException.php 创建自定义异常类 app/lib/exception/ExceptionHandler.php 修改thinkphp6异常类使用自定义的异常类 app ...
考虑到有些功能是复用的,可以将一些复用的功能放到一个服务里面公用 例如:公共模块新建一个服务类: 示例: 具体使用: 第二种方法: 示例: 具体使用: ...
2018-05-25 09:51 0 839 推荐指数:
创建自定义异常类基类 app/lib/exception/BaseException.php 创建自定义异常类 app/lib/exception/ExceptionHandler.php 修改thinkphp6异常类使用自定义的异常类 app ...
在做一个项目,在项目完成之后,配置一下路由,让URL更容易美观。 下面是具体的配置: Common / Conf / config.php 上面的配置完成之后: ...
在项目的开发过程中异常抛出尤为重要不仅能够做出友好提示帮助掩盖我们伟大的程序员们尴尬的瞬间,还能做到提示开发人员代码白编写的错误,下面进行自定义异常抛出类,纯属个人理解,希望大家指正 首先在框架中我们可以自定义目录结构用来做异常类的存储位置例如文件目录为以下红框中 定义目录结构后阐述一下 ...
1.配置config.php 自定义异常路径: 2. ...
----------------------------------------Action中使用的系统常量 ----------------------------------------THINK_PATH // ThinkPHP 系统目录APP_PATH // 当前项目目录APP_NAME ...
这些,我们只需要做以下两步工作: 一、写自定义函数 1、在项目的Commo ...
最近做了一个项目,使用的是我自己基于thinkphp开发的一套CMS,由于我本地使用的都是apche的环境,即使是线上环境用的也是宝塔面板,但是现在要将thinkphp的系统部署在IIS8.0的环境下,由于路由我设置过伪静态,而原本的 .htaccess 在 IIS 环境下没有什么作用,所以需要 ...
在项目的开发过程中异常抛出尤为重要不仅能够做出友好提示帮助掩盖我们伟大的程序员们尴尬的瞬间,还能做到提示开发人员代码白编写的错误,下面进行自定义异常抛出类,纯属个人理解,希望大家指正 首先在框架中我们可以自定义目录结构用来做异常类的存储位置例如文件目录为以下红框中 定义目录结构后阐述一下 ...